Ed Deedigan

As director of Kandu Arts for Sustainable Development and a director of Kandu Arts Community Projects CIC, Ed has over 25 years experience of working with, for, and giving voice to marginalised individuals and groups. Using his experience in the music industry and more recently in film making Ed knows and uses the potential of Arts mediums along with strong mentoring and support to bring about change, empower individuals and communities locally and nationally. Kandu’s multifaceted methodology and success has led to Ed being invited as consultant on many areas regarding community engagement, sustainable practices and in working with and giving voice to young people and their communities. Ed regularly contributes to a local newspaper column, writes topical songs and collaborates on film projects.
